African Union Urges Senegal to Set Date for Presidential Elections Amid Postponement Controversy

The African Union called on Senegal to set a date for holding the presidential elections that were scheduled for February 25, which outgoing President Macky Sall announced was postponed on Saturday to an unspecified date due to a dispute over the list of candidates. President Macky Sall Renews XËYU Ndaw ÑI Program for Three Years and Highlights Financial Support for Youth and Women

The President of the Republic praised the efforts of his regime in financing women and young people. “I am happy to announce that I have renewed the XËYU Ndaw ÑI Program for three years, covering 82,000 youth jobs for an amount of 450 billion CFA francs. Ousmane Sonko: New Charges and Legal Troubles Timeline

The day after the opponent’s arrest, the public prosecutor Abdoul Karim Diop held a press conference to charge Ousmane Sonko with new charges. Senegal: the Supreme Court jeopardizes Sonko’s chances of participating in the 2024 presidential election

The Senegalese Supreme Court delivered its verdict this Friday, November 17, 2023, on the appeal of the State of Senegal against Ousmane Sonko.
